Senki Zesshou Symphogear
戦姫絶唱シンフォギア


symphogear.jpg

Two years ago, a pair of idols, Tsubasa Kazanari and Kanade Amō, collectively known as ZweiWing, fought against an alien race known as Noise using armor known as Symphogear. To protect a girl named Hibiki Tachibana, who got severely wounded by the Noise, Kanade sacrificed herself. Two years later, as Tsubasa has fought the Noise alone, Hibiki ends up gaining the same power as Kanade.

Cast: Mizuki Nana, Minami Takayama, Yuuki Aoi, Yuka Iguchi

Original creator: Akifumi Kaneko, Noriyasu Agematsu
Animation Studio: Encourage Films
Director: Tatsufumi Ito
Series Composition: Akifumi Kaneko
Music: Elements Garden

This series had so much potential in its bag. Coming off an impressive first few episodes, the later parts of the show simply snowballed to disaster. The all-girls action with swords, guns and missiles and fists were nice, I mean, look at the final episode, completely action-packed. Drama-wise, its quite badly done, especially with Miku. Overall, it was an excellent effort from the company, there was a clear direction of the show after Chris' appearance, awesome songs and music, and decent budget, judging from no failures in clear in the animation or drawing side.

Below are my personal opinions about the bad parts, its is subjective and personal:

1. Yuki Aoi CANT sing. No, hell she cant. Listening to her insert fighting song whenever she transformed makes me wanna plug my ears. You dont get inexperienced girl to sing along with the reigning(and all time best) seiyuu-singer in Mizuki Nana-sama and Takgaki Ayahi, whom I tout as one the better seiyuu-singers along side Tamura Yukari and Kitamura Eri. GAWD, I repeat again, SHE CANT SING, and this will draw me to my next point.

2. Characters are bore. Hibiki as a main character really just doesnt stand out. The first episodes had Tsubasa in lead until she 'damaged' herself, Hibiki's role as the heroine isnt really worth remembering. Her design is bland and tasteless, definitely not someone you would want to remember the show from. Tsubasa too, had little airtime and development. Her character development stems from hallucinating her dead partner, not once, but multiple occasions. Chris is by far, my favorite character. Not because of her angst statements weekly, its because she really does stand out from the others with a real background which one can sympathise from, and cute moments that prove that she isnt really what she wants to appear to be.

Overall, good show. Everyone can look back once they are finished with it and give a thumbs up.
